Output 3aa52985352b85e176f0b0a77e17b5159edc925d8e2f2305bf2d4dc17f94d989:25

value
107939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54d2ca22a4335f3d8939c21ea444a24899d62789 OP_EQUAL
address
39RXCaJkMSNCo1BDYW5AnxpCZJwV2SeH6a
transaction
3aa52985352b85e176f0b0a77e17b5159edc925d8e2f2305bf2d4dc17f94d989
spent
true